摘要

The triple-period (TP)-A and CuPt-A type ordering, which have been so far reported only for MBE grown alloys, were observed, in addition to CuPt-B type ordering, in Al{sub}0.5In{sub}0.5As alloys grown by MOVPE at 500°C. This indicates that (2×3) and (1×2) surface reconstructions occur on the surface even during MOVPE growth, although the (2×1) surface reconstruction and CuPt-B type ordering are dominant for the growth conditions examined.
